Output d0b809b8120aa80cb79c63378e5af7dfc0c305b23f0ce41b1a4942a2059fa61b:3

value
3295327
script pubkey
OP_0 OP_PUSHBYTES_20 cbac149384746bc1e288f18a5d37881d9a1c0d30
address
bc1qewkpfyuyw34urc5g7x996dugrkdpcrfssy5qg8
transaction
d0b809b8120aa80cb79c63378e5af7dfc0c305b23f0ce41b1a4942a2059fa61b
confirmations
58236
spent
true